How did jeffersons views about the constitution implied powers differ from the views of Alexander Hamilton?

Jefferson's views differed from Hamilton's because Jefferson believed that implied powers are the powers that are "absolutely necessary" to carry out expressed powers, but Hamilton thought it meant that they were not expressly forbidden in the Constitution.

What court case upheld the use of implied powers by congress in any way they see needed?

McCulloch vs Maryland was the court case that upheld the use of implied powers by Congress in any way they saw needed.

How are expressed powers and implied powers related?

Express powers are stated explicitly in the instrument confering the power. Implied powers are 'implied' from the function. So if a Minister has the power to make a decision it might be implied that he or she can hold an inquiry first.
